Is there such thing as a digital camera photo printer without needing a computer? ?

My friends have a digital camera, but no computer. I think giving them the photo printer (like the EasyShare by Kodak) would be a great gift, but the ones I've seen so far need a computer. This may be a dumb question, and I am aware of that, lol.. but I'm hoping that it exists?

Thanks!


yes... look for a camera and printer with "PictBridge" capability.

http://www.digicamhelp.com/processing-ph otos/printing/pictbridge.php

"PictBridge is a standardized technology that allows printing images from a memory card in a digital camera directly to a printer, regardless of brand.*

The technology completely bypasses the need for a computer. Each PictBridge device is automatically recognized by the other.

The camera compares its PictBridge functions to the functions of the printer. The camera then displays the supported functions on menus on the LCD screen or in the viewfinder."


Many regular printers (for word processing, etc.) have PictBridge.. you don't need a special printer.

You hook up the PictBridge capable camera and Pictbridge capable printer via USB and print directly from the camera.
This will work whether you are using the camera's memory card or built-in internal memory.

can you please help me pick up a digital photo camera ?

i am mainly interested in a digital photo camera that will allow me to make very good pictures at night. i am planning to go on a trip around Europe and the camera that i have only takes good pictures at day. during the night, the pictures taken are blurry and out of focus. i tried every feature it had but the result was the same. i want to be able to take a photo of the moon, of Belgrade at night and any other lighted building. i know that it is possible. i just want to know with what kind of camera i can do that.


For taking night photgraphs, you need a camera which is having shutter speed manual control + you will be requiring a tripod, to take photos with slow shutter speeds

I am using Sony cybershot DSCH-1, which is having minimum speed of 30 seconds, which is more then enough for night photo graphy. here are a few samples of night photgraphy from this camera

    SAN JOSE, Calif. - Nov. 6, 2009 - Adobe Systems Incorporated (Nasdaq:ADBE) today introduced the Photoshop.com Mobile for Android software, extending Adobe industry-leading digital imaging technology to users of the Google Mobile operating system. The release comes less than a month after the launch of Photoshop.com Mobile for iPhone, which quickly established itself as one of the "Top Free" applications on the Apple mobile platform. The Android application equips consumers with quick and easy image-editing tools, color adjustments and instant photo-sharing capabilities. Photoshop.com Mobile optimizes the camera-phone experience by allowing users to browse for their photos online and on their phone, directly from the application. The application is free and available today at the Android Market.

    "Adobe is excited to extend its digital imaging capabilities to Android phone users so they can take control of their growing collections of mobile photos," said Doug Mack, vice president and general manager of Consumer and Hosted Solutions at Adobe. "Photoshop.com Mobile is a great resource to edit, upload and share photos in a few short moments. It's the perfect complement to the mobile phone cameras found on Android devices."
